Solution Overview
Problem
In lithium-ion secondary batteries with grooves in the positive or negative electrode active material layers, it is difficult to determine the presence of metal impurities using insulation inspection tests due to reduced contact area between metal impurities and electrodes.
Innovation Solution
A lithium-ion secondary battery design where at least one of the electrode active material layers has a groove, with a conductive layer on the separator surface facing the groove, facilitating easier detection of metal impurities during insulation inspection tests.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Productivity
If a groove is formed in the electrode active material layer to facilitate electrolyte penetration, then the battery performance is improved, but the contact area between metal impurities and the electrode is reduced, making insulation inspection difficult
Solution Approach 1:
A conductive layer is introduced as an intermediary between the groove and the electrode active material layer. This conductive layer fills the groove and provides a continuous conductive path from the groove to the electrode, enabling effective insulation inspection while maintaining the groove's beneficial effects on electrolyte penetration and battery performance
Solution Approach 2:
The conductive layer extends the detection path from a two-dimensional surface contact to a three-dimensional volume that includes the groove depth. By filling the groove with conductive material, the inspection test can detect metal impurities through the vertical dimension of the groove, not just at the surface level

A lithium-ion secondary battery includes: an electrode body in which a positive electrode having a positive electrode active material layer and a positive electrode current collector, and a negative electrode having a negative electrode active material layer and a negative electrode current collector, are laminated with a separator therebetween, the separator having a conductive layer, wherein: the positive electrode active material layer and the negative electrode active material layer contact the separator, at least one of the positive electrode active material layer or the negative electrode active material layer has a groove in a thickness direction, and a surface of the separator, which faces a surface of the at least one of the positive electrode active material layer or the negative electrode active material layer which has the groove, includes the conductive layer.
